Using Carbon Isotopes to Fight the Rise in Fraudulent Whisky
Recent interest in the analysis of whisky, based on corrected fraction modern radiocarbon (F14C) measurements, transpired while we were creating an independent calibration curve to extrapolate the F14C values beyond the published limit of 2010. Three 'rare' bottles of whisky proven to be fakes. At that point, we were measuring F14C values in a range of modern human forensic samples for UK Police Forces, and biofuels from the petrochemical industry.
